Solutions30 and GlasfaserPlus just signed an agreement to roll-out a fibre optic FTTH network, starting from the regions of Saarland and Bayern in Germany. The agreement is a further step in GlasfaserPlus? ambition to support its goal of giving high-speed internet access up to 4 million households in Germany's rural and small and medium-sized urban areas in the coming years.

The two partners intend to provide turnkey FTTH services of both Homes Passed and Homes Connected. With this new agreement in Germany, Solutions30 continues its extensive development in the high-speed internet access across Europe. With a strong expertise acquired in France, Belgium, Spain and the Netherlands, Solutions30 is now expanding in Germany, where the group intends to position itself in the top players of the market.
